Preca Community Garden aims at building community and at connecting young people with nature by growing organic produce.

Preca Community Garden is a backyard garden situated at Brompton in the inner western suburbs in Adelaide. The land is owned by Preca Community which is an non-profit educational organisation affiliated to the Catholic Church. The project which stated in mid-2011 trials innovative gardening practices for dense and water efficient urban organic vegetable and fruit gardening

Preca Community Garden Upgrade 15/02/2018

To improve accessibility and provide a playing space for young children and families the primary pathways were paved and a new drought resistant lawn was installed. The automatic water system was extended to enable the garden to survive heat waves. We thank the Preca Community and The City of Charles Stuart Council for financing this project. Fox Gardens completed the project to full satisfaction.

Preca Wicking Raised Bed refurbishment 12/02/2018

After 7 years two wicking raised beds have been refurbished. About 3 years ago all beds developed leaks due to termites and tree roots. Preca is trialing vinyl rather than builder's plastic. Hope it lasts!
